Tuesdays And Fridays examines modern relational autonomy through a unique, scheduled romantic arrangement. The film's strength lies in its departure from traditional romantic milestones, emphasizing personal ability to act over societal expectations. However, the narrative remains limited in its exploration of broader social diversities. Without explicit details about racial backgrounds or LGBTQ+ identities, the film's engagement with diverse communities is constrained. Ultimately, the film serves as a critique of lifelong monogamy and traditional social contracts, focusing more on individualistic lifestyle choices than on varied identity representation.
Category Breakdown
The film centers on a heterosexual relationship between Varun and Sia. There is no clear depiction of LGBTQ+ identities or non-straight relationships.
Sia is portrayed as a strong, independent entertainment lawyer who maintains intellectual equality with Varun. This portrayal challenges traditional gender roles and avoids typical patriarchal romantic themes.
The names Varun and Sia might suggest South Asian heritage, but the film does not explicitly confirm any specific racial dynamics or a predominantly non-white cast.
The story questions traditional Western romantic ideals and the nuclear family structure, emphasizing individualistic lifestyle choices over conventional social norms.
There is no indication of visible or invisible disabilities in the narrative. The film does not explore how neurodivergence or physical health affects the characters.

Official Synopsis
Varun is a bestselling author and Sia is an entertainment lawyer. They both have their distinct way of looking at love. To avoid the burden of commitment, they agree to be romantic partners for only two days a week.
